Need Help? The SAMHSA National Helpline Offers Support
The SAMHSA National Helpline is a free service available around the clock to individuals and families struggling with mental health or chemicals substance use disorders. This valuable resource connects users with trained assistants who can offer guidance, referrals to local treatment options, and details about available resources.
